Andrew Dunkley

    Questo autore porta nella sua opera una vasta esperienza di radiodiffusione e giornalismo, che ha plasmato una voce narrativa unica. La sua lunga carriera nei media ha affinato la sua abilità nel raccontare storie avvincenti e nel collegare argomenti diversi. Il passaggio da varie stazioni radio australiane a un focus sui podcast di astronomia dimostra una curiosità costante e un desiderio di condividere conoscenze. Questa miscela di precisione giornalistica e fascino per il cosmo conferisce al suo lavoro profondità e un'ampia prospettiva.

      In the early 23rd Century, time travel has become a reality. For years, the Infinity Generator remains unused as governments debate the ramifications of potential alterations to the past until one nation, Germany, proposes the correction of humanity's worst atrocity, The Holocaust. The United Nations agrees and a committee is formed to work up a plan. They decide that erasing Adolph Hitler from history is the best way to achieve their goal. They study his life, find his vulnerabilities and finally execute their attack. Like many before them, they fail and with that a new and terrible foe becomes aware of their intentions, hell bent on revenge. Now the U.N. must fight against time itself to achieve success before the future, the present and the past are controlled by the Fourth Reich.

      The invasion of the Andromeda Galaxy by the Borche brings devastation as they ruthlessly attack the seven worlds, leaving destruction in their wake. The inhabitants valiantly resist but face a formidable enemy known for their discipline and relentless pursuit of extermination and slavery. This conflict highlights themes of survival and the struggle against an overpowering adversary, capturing the dire circumstances of the colonies under siege.
